standalone XPS Viewer
























XPS Annotator is an exclusive standalone XPS Viewer (not hosted in Microsoft Internet Explorer), they adding some features including annotations, document properties, digital signatures, XPS converter and sidebar for ease of reading. Main Features: * Allow you to add notes or comments to an XPS documents to flag information or to highlight items of interest for later reference, support for adding text notes, ink notes, and highlight annotations. * Can adding document properties to your XPS documents (creator, identifier, content-type, title, subject, description, keywords, language, category), this feature will help you to manage your XPS documents easily. * Ability to converts Microsoft XML Paper Specification (XPS) to an image files. * Built-in sidebar for ease of reading. The sidebar contains a thumbnails from all pages, you can jumping from one page to another by clicking the thumbnails. * Support security features, such as digital signatures to provide greater document security. * Support for common operations including save-a-copy, print-output, copy-to-clipboard, zoom, and text-search.
